The authors presented a review of studies aimed at assessing the effectiveness of antiangiogenic therapy in patients with neovascular form of age-related macular degeneration. The purpose of this review was to clarify the prevalence of true refractory forms of WMD on literary data. The vast majority of experts consider the marker of “refractory” the exit of the dye from the vessels on fluorescent angiography (FAG), fibrovascular detachment of pigment epithelium with intraretinal and/or subretinal fluid on optical coherent tomography, an increase in hemorrhage on the eye compared to the initial level of post-loading phase therapy. The analysis showed a wide corridor of indicators, due to different approaches and timing of the assessment of the respondent’s status, as well as expert criteria for the effectiveness of antiangiogenic therapy. In addition, the authors drew attention to the different understanding of the terms tahiphylaxis and tolerance, presented by the researchers. Many papers are replacing these perceptions. The our work presents the fundamental differences of these biological phenomena in the clinic and morphometric data, as well as the timing of development. Meanwhile, overcoming resistance involves an accurate diagnosis of the pharmacological cause and a subsequent differentiated approach to solving the problem. An overview of the work on overcoming refractory to antiangiogenic drugs in various ways is presented.
